Introduction
A bearish split strike synthetic is a sophisticated options strategy designed to simulate the payoff of a short stock position using only option contracts. By combining a long put at a lower strike and a short call at a higher strike—both with the same expiration date—it forms a synthetic short position. This strategy offers traders a way to express a bearish market view without borrowing shares, while controlling risk and capital requirements.
Strategy Construction
Components
- Long Put (Lower Strike): Grants the right (but not obligation) to sell the underlying at strike K₁, offering protection if the asset’s price falls significantly.
- Short Call (Higher Strike): Obligates the trader to sell the underlying at strike K₂ if assigned, generating income through call premium.
The strikes are typically set near the current asset price, with K₁ (put) at-the-money or slightly out-of-the-money, and K₂ (call) at-the-money or slightly out-of-the-money.
Synthetic Short Equity Position
Combined, these positions replicate short stock exposure:
- A downward move in the underlying increases the put’s value, generating profit.
- An upward move exposes the trader to loss via the short call obligation.
Through put-call parity, this combination mimics shorting the underlying directly but requires less capital and avoids share borrowing costs.

Strategy Management
Assignment And Early Exercise
The short call can be assigned anytime, especially if in-the-money or ex-dividend. If assigned, the trader must sell stock at strike K₂ and manage resulting short positions. It’s important to monitor assignment risk and account for ex-dividend timing. The long put is less likely to be exercised early.
